It can be hard to translate regular season success to the playoffs, but Lindsay had no problem doing just that on Friday. They took down the Chatsworth Chancellors 35-20. Winning may never get old, but the Cardinals sure are getting used to it with their fifth in a row.
Lindsay got their win on the backs of several key players, but it was Jose Cortes out in front who rushed for 148 yards and two touchdowns. Cortes' rushing production has been exceptional as that marked his fifth straight game with at least 137 rushing yards. Lindsay also got a significant boost from Ethan Cortes, who ran away from the competition to the tune of 125 yards.
Jose was just one part of a punishing run game: Lindsay was unstoppable on the ground and finished the game with 332 rushing yards.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now rushed for at least 223 rushing yards in five consecutive contests.
Lindsay's victory bumped their record up to 10-5. As for Chatsworth, with the loss, they broke their five-game winning streak and moved their record to 9-6.
Lindsay will be playing in front of their home fans against Moreau Catholic at 4:00 p.m. on Friday. Moreau Catholic will roll in looking for their sixth straight win, something Lindsay surely won't give up without a fight. Chatsworth does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
